EQUITY MARKETS ADVISORY COMMITTEE No. 13-07     RE: ICI COMMENT LETTER ON IOSCO CONSULTATION ON SOFT COMMISSIONS

 

The Institute submitted the attached comment letter to the International Organization of Securities Commissions (IOSCO) on March 15, 2007.  The letter responds to the IOSCO Technical Committee’s Consultation Report on Soft Commission Arrangements, which was published in late November 2006. [1] 

 

The IOSCO Report did not attempt to develop general principles regarding soft commission arrangements, recognizing that the relevant law in many jurisdictions is changing.  Instead, the Report identified potential conflicts of interest created by soft commission arrangements and presented the results of a survey of the soft commission regulatory regimes of the nineteen jurisdictions that participate in IOSCO’s Standing Committee on Investment Management.

 

The Institute’s letter welcomes the Technical Committee’s assessment that soft commission arrangements can provide value to fund investors by facilitating fund managers’ access to research and other services that enhance investment decisions.  The letter then briefly discusses the importance of fiduciary principles and oversight, limitations on services that may be obtained with soft commissions, and disclosure in managing potential conflicts of interest. [2]  The letter also expresses strong support for the Technical Committee’s decision to monitor changes in relevant law before attempting to develop general principles concerning soft commission arrangements.
